FlashLabs Unveils New Identity to Lead in Autonomous AI Innovation
On January 19, 2026, FlashIntel made a notable move by rebranding itself as FlashLabs. This change signifies not just a new name but a crucial pivot in the company's journey towards becoming a frontrunner in autonomous AI solutions. The organization, known for its robust AI-powered sales and market intelligence offerings, is evolving into an applied research lab, dedicated to the development and implementation of autonomous systems that transform customer engagement and operational frameworks.
The founder, Yi Shi, highlighted that the rebranding is a clear indicator of FlashLabs' commitment to advancing the capabilities of AI from merely task-oriented tools to sophisticated systems capable of autonomous operation. Shi emphasized, "Our mission remains unchanged: we aim to dismantle barriers for businesses around the globe, yet we are advancing our capabilities towards more ambitious objectives."
FlashLabs, since its inception in late 2022, has been instrumental in unifying sales intelligence for various organizations while automating workflows that enhance revenue operations.
